In recent years, cruise travel has become increasingly popular. According to data from the Cruise Lines International Association (CLIA), it is estimated that 35.7 million passengers will take cruises in 2024, and an additional 4 million new cruise passengers will be added in 2025.

Many people choose to travel by cruise ship because of the all-inclusive service, where accommodation, dining, and entertainment are all provided onboard and included in the ticket price, making it an economically affordable and leisurely vacation.

However, before embarking on a cruise, passengers should also pay attention to the following seven key points to ensure a pleasant and smooth journey:

1. Destination and Itinerary:

When choosing a cruise, it is essential to determine the desired destinations and routes and the attractions and ports of call along the way.

2. Budget:

Cruise travel costs include fares, gratuities, additional service fees, and shore excursion expenses, so it’s essential to consider the budget in advance.

3. Ship Selection:

Cruise ships offer different styles and facilities, so it’s essential to consider your preferences and needs when choosing.

4. Onboard Activities:

Confirm whether onboard activities and entertainment facilities cater to your interests to maximize your cruise travel experience.

5. Dining: 

Inquire about the dining options available onboard, including formal dinners, buffets, and specialty restaurants, to satisfy your culinary preferences.

6. Health and Safety: 

Pay attention to the medical services and safety measures onboard the cruise ship, and prepare necessary medications and insurance documents.

7. Booking Timing: 

Booking a cruise in advance can secure better prices and room choices, avoiding last-minute rush before departure.
